§ 40-36-60 — Adoption of rules and regulations; seal.

Text
The board may adopt rules governing its proceedings as provided for in Section 40-1-60 and may adopt an official seal bearing the words "South Carolina Board of Occupational Therapy". The board shall promulgate regulations necessary to carry out the provisions of this chapter including, but not limited to, promulgating in regulation a code of ethics.

Legislative History
HISTORY: 1977 Act No. 139 SECTION 6; 1982 Act No. 390, SECTION 1; 1994 Act No. 401, SECTION 1; 1998 Act No. 356, SECTION 1.
